Least Common Multiple of 35610 and 35620 with GCF Formula

The formula of LCM is LCM(a,b) = ( a × b) / GCF(a,b).
We need to calculate greatest common factor 35610 and 35620, than apply into the LCM equation.

GCF(35610,35620) = 10
LCM(35610,35620) = ( 35610 × 35620) / 10
LCM(35610,35620) = 1268428200 / 10
LCM(35610,35620) = 126842820
